The basics of baby back ribs: Why they're unique, how to prepare them, seasoning ideas, cooking tips, plus times and temperatures for smoking. When you buy baby back ribs at the store, look for cuts that have more meat on the front of the ribs. That meat is loin meat — it's very delicious and tender.
